Join Will and his guest for a remarkable insight into life as a chaplain in the Armed Forces. Rev James Burnett from Belfast is a chaplain in the Royal Naval Reserve. Known as "Bish" or "Padre", whilst on deployment he regularly hears serving men and women ask why they rarely meet any Christians. This is his mission field. Send us a text Light and hope in great darkness. Kerry and Will welcome Ben McMechan, the Northern Ireland lead for IJM, International Justice Mission. In partnership with organisations and authorities across the world, they tackle slavery, violence and exploitation, case by case.
